Complaint Investigation Summary Report #: 5105 <br />COMPLAINT ID: C00055093 Site Location: E HAZELTON AVE & AURORA ST <br />Activity Summary <br />Activity Date <br />08/03/2022 Spoke with Robert Isom of Patriot Environmental. Robert stated that Patriot <br />Environmental was on site Tuesday (8/2) night. He provided me with Matt Musoffs <br />contact information (916-347-8717) since Matt was the person on site conducting <br />clean up. I called Matt who stated they were on site last night and per Matt they did <br />not secure the area. They were on site today (8/3/22) to conduct clean up and <br />stated they completed clean up by around 9:30am. I was not contacted to observe <br />clean up and per Matt they had left the area already. Received pictures and exact <br />location from Matt via text. Per Matt, waste was going to be hauled off as <br />non-hazardous to the Yolo Landfill because the contents were acrylic and latex <br />and they were dry making them non-hazardous. Per Matt, waste was collected in a <br />20-yard roll off bin. Per Matt, no sampling was conducted. I called Michael Algots <br />with UPRR and informed him what Matt Musoff had told me. Michael stated he <br />would speak with Matt. Received a call back from Michael apologizing and stating <br />that he had notified Patriot to secure the area, that they contact me when clean up <br />is being conducted and make a hazardous waste determination. Michael stated <br />that he would have Patriot collect samples and make a hazardous waste <br />determination. Per Michael, the roll off bin will be brought back to the site where <br />contents were collected, near Mormon Slough. Per Matt, roll off bin contains four <br />locks and is secured. <br />Called Matt inquiring whether the roll off bin had been brought back to the site. Per <br />Matt, a 1/2 gallon ziploc bag of soil sample was collected and will be sent off to <br />Pace Labs for a hazardous waste determination. Received a copy of the chain of <br />custody from Matt via text. <br />Recorded by <br />GARCIA-MEJIA <br />09/13/2022 Contacted Michael Algots regarding the status of the samples and if they received GARCIA-MEJIA <br />final results from the lab. <br />09/15/2022 Reviewed analytical results via email from Ambrose Kong GARCIA-MEJIA <br /><Ambrose.Kong@patriotenvironmental.com>. No hazardous values were <br />detected. Replied to email thread asking whether the waste has already been <br />disposed of and if so how? Ambrose replied to my email stating that the waste has <br />not yet been disposed of but the plan is to dispose of it as non-hazardous at the <br />Potrero Hills Landfill. <br />10/25/2022 Emailed Ambrose Kong with Patriot Environmental to follow up my email on GARCIA-MEJIA <br />9/15/22 to see if they have disposed of the waste. <br />12/01/2022 Waste was sheduled to be disposed of on 11/4/22. I emailed Ambrose Kong to GARCIA-MEJIA <br />check in and see if it was taken to the landfill as scheduled and reminded him to <br />please provide me with a copy of the final disposal record. <br />Received copy of the signed non-hazardous waste manifest as well as the Potrero <br />Hills Landfill weight ticket via email from Ambrose Kong <br /><Ambrose.Kong@patriotenvironnnental.com>. Waste was disposed of at the <br />landfill on 10/29/22. Saved email and waste records to the file. <br />12/05/2022 Printed out all necessary forms and abated the complaint.
